Diya 2.0

Microplate Illuminator with Active Temperature Control

A precision microwell plate illuminator designed for mammalian, bacterial, and yeast cell applications as well as photoredox catalysis. It offers unparalleled flexibility for controlling light delivery, allowing independent adjustment of wavelength, intensity, and temporal patterns for each individual well.

The Diya 2.0 serves similar purposes as the optoPlate, the optoPlate-96, the Light Plate Apparatus (LPA), LITOS, Lustro, and the optoWell. Up to 7 wavelengths
From UVA through the visible spectrum to NIR, with high uniformity and irradiance on every channel

Active Temperature Control
Keep your samples at the right temperature. No more heat effects masquerading as phototoxicity
Individual Well Control
Independent wavelength and intensity control for each of the 96 wells. Also compatible with 24 and 6-well plates via easily swappable adapters
Automation Ready
Compatible with incubators, liquid handlers, flow cytometers and any deep-well plate compatible instrument
